Subject: Re: FLASH: how to select all of the instances on a layer?
From: Michael Penne
Date: Tue, 28 Sep 1999 21:51:47 +0100

F5-shift to push/pull (actually adds or deletes
frames) works on a Mac also, Also: shift-select at the
start and end of the group of frames and drag them
where you want them (works over multiple layers also).
